Founded in 2003 in Saitama, LED RECHWE was an obscure Japanese fashion brand that drew inspiration from American and Japanese rock aesthetics, producing garments with distinctive denim treatments and bold silhouettes. Despite its unique designs, LED RECHWE remained relatively under the radar and ceased operations in the early 2010s, making their pieces extremely hard to come by. This particular pair of denim was from the label’s luxury line; VERONICA, known as the “Crazy Racer” flare denim, they featured heavy mud-wash and intentional distressing details with military-inspired cargo pockets throughout.
